What is the Tavily Tool?

The Tavily tool is a feature-rich integration that allows users to connect and interact directly with Tavily's powerful search API. It supports a comprehensive search tool that allows for fine-tuned control over web searches. With Hatz AI now connected to this tool, you can automate research tasks, get quick summaries, and perform intelligent information retrieval across the web.


How Can a User Access Tavily?

Tavily is an AI Powered Search tool that is available in the Tool Selector and does not require user authentication.


Features of the Tavily Integration Tool

1. Comprehensive Web Search

  • Perform detailed and accurate web searches using a simple query.

  • Use Hatz AI to automate the process of finding relevant information from a vast array of web sources.

2. Customizable Search Depth

  • Control the depth of your search to be either "basic" for quick results or more advanced for in-depth research.

  • Let Hatz AI analyze results from different search depths to provide comprehensive summaries.

3. Control Over Number of Results

  • Specify the maximum number of search results you want to receive, with a default of 5.

  • Optimize your workflow by only retrieving the most relevant number of sources for your needs.

4. Advanced Domain Filtering

  • Focus your search by including or excluding specific domains.

  • Ensure your results are from the most trusted and relevant sources for your query.

5. Diverse Content Types

  • Choose to include or exclude various types of content in your search results, including:

    • Direct answers to your queries.

    • Raw HTML content for detailed analysis.

    • Images to supplement your research.

Tavily & Hatz AI: Use Case List

This list outlines practical applications of the Hatz AI and Tavily. It is categorized by the type of research task, providing examples of direct Chat Prompts for quick, ad-hoc queries and Workflow Automations for more structured, repeatable research processes.

1. Market & Competitive Intelligence

Use Case

Description

Chat Prompt Example

Workflow for Automation

Quick Competitor Snapshot

Get an immediate, high-level summary of a competitor's recent activities, news, and product offerings.

Give me a summary of our competitor, "Acme Innovations," based on their recent online activity.

Competitor Profile Builder Workflow:
1. Prompts the user for the competitor's name and website domain.
2. Performs a deep web search, filtering results to include only the competitor's domain and major news sites.
3. Hatz AI synthesizes the findings into key sections: Recent News, Product Offerings, and Online Presence.
4. Presents a consolidated report to the user.

Market Trend Analysis

Quickly understand the latest trends, discussions, and key developments within a specific industry or technology sector.

What are the top 3 trends in the renewable energy sector for this year? Summarize each and provide sources.

Weekly Industry Trends Workflow:
1. Prompts the user to specify an industry or topic.
2. Asks the user to list 2-3 trusted industry news domains (e.g., forbes.com, techcrunch.com).
3. Executes an advanced search focused only on those domains for the latest articles on that topic.
4. Hatz AI generates a bulleted list of key trends with a one-sentence summary for each.

Product Feature Comparison

Gather information on how a competitor's product features compare to your own.

Find information on the new "AI Analytics" feature from our competitor, "DataCorp Inc."

Feature Analysis Workflow:
1. Prompts for the competitor's product name and the feature to investigate.
2. Performs a targeted search for reviews, press releases, and documentation about that feature.
3. Excludes your company's own domain to avoid internal results.
4. Hatz AI extracts and summarizes the core capabilities, pricing, and user feedback from the search results.

2. Content Creation & Research

Use Case

Description

Chat Prompt Example

Workflow for Automation

Gathering Authoritative Sources

Find credible sources, studies, and statistics to back up claims in a blog post, article, or presentation.

Find 5 authoritative sources for a blog post about the benefits of remote work, excluding blog domains.

Blog Post Source Finder Workflow:
1. Prompts the user for the main topic of their content piece.
2. Asks for the desired number of sources (e.g., 5, 10).
3. Performs a search that includes domains like .edu, .gov, and major news outlets, while excluding common blog platforms.
4. Hatz AI provides a list of sources with links and a brief summary of each source's key points.

Content Outline Generation

Generate a structured outline for an article or report based on existing high-ranking information on the web.

Create a blog post outline on the topic "Getting Started with 3D Printing at Home".

AI-Powered Content Outliner Workflow:
1. User provides the core topic or title.
2. The workflow performs a web search to analyze the structure of top-ranking articles on that topic.
3. Hatz AI identifies common themes, headings, and sub-points.
4. It generates a logical, hierarchical outline (H1, H2s, H3s) for the user to use as a starting point.

Fact-Checking a Claim

Quickly verify a statistic or claim by finding corroborating evidence from reputable sources online.

Fact-check this: "Is coffee the most consumed beverage in the world after water?" Provide links to your sources.

Quick Fact-Checker Workflow:
1. User inputs the statement or statistic they want to verify.
2. The workflow performs a search using the claim as a query.
3. It prioritizes results from encyclopedic, academic, or reputable data-journalism sites.
4. Hatz AI provides a "Verified," "False," or "Debated" status along with 1-2 direct quotes and links to the supporting sources.

3. General Information & Summarization

Use Case

Description

Chat Prompt Example

Workflow for Automation

Quick Topic Explainer

Get up to speed on any new concept, event, or topic with a concise, easy-to-digest summary.

Explain the concept of "blockchain technology" in simple terms.

Topic Briefer Workflow:
1. User enters the topic or concept they want to learn about.
2. The workflow performs a "basic" search to get a quick, high-level overview from the top 3 results.
3. Hatz AI synthesizes the information into a single, comprehensive summary, including a simple analogy if applicable.
4. Presents the summary to the user.

Daily News Briefing

Get a personalized summary of the day's top news stories related to specific areas of interest.

Give me a summary of today's top 3 news stories in the world of artificial intelligence.

Personalized News Digest Workflow:
1. Prompts the user to define 1-3 topics of interest (e.g., 'Finance', 'Space Exploration').
2. For each topic, it runs a search for news from the last 24 hours.
3. Hatz AI summarizes the single most important story for each topic.
4. It compiles the summaries into a single, easy-to-read briefing for the user.

Image Sourcing for Presentations

Find relevant, commercially usable images to supplement research or presentations.

Find me 3 high-quality images of "solar panels on a residential roof".

Presentation Image Finder Workflow:
1. Prompts the user for a description of the image they need.
2. The workflow executes a search, with the "include_images" parameter enabled.
3. To help with compliance, it can optionally add search terms like "royalty-free" or filter to include domains like unsplash.com or pexels.com.
4. Presents a gallery of the retrieved images for the user to choose from.
